In 2024, the hiring market for semi-skilled roles faced persistent challenges. According to the statistics from the Ministry of Manpower, roles such as waiters, cleaners, and customer service often remain unfilled for over six months. Key barriers included physically demanding conditions, unattractive pay, unfavourable work schedules, and unappealing work environments. These trends emphasise the growing difficulties for semi-skilled jobseekers balancing rising personal expenses and employment hurdles. Jobstreet Express have stepped in to address these gaps by matching candidates with suitable opportunities based on their interests, experience, and job requirements, while enabling businesses to recruit swiftly to meet urgent demands.

Between Q1 and Q3 of 2024, the platform experienced more than tripled growth in retail industry job postings, reflecting the fast turnover and high demand for semi-skilled roles. This growth aligns with broader market trends, such as increased hiring activity in response to labor shortages and shifting consumer behaviors. While new client acquisitions contributed to this increase, the growth also underscores the platform's role in meeting the industry's urgent workforce needs. The surge in activity points to Jobstreet Express becoming a trusted go-to solution for businesses struggling to fill positions critical to their operations.

Looking ahead to 2025, Jobstreet Express foresees significant transformations in the labour market driven by several key factors. Advancements in technology will continue to reshape skill requirements, making digital literacy and adaptability critical for job seekers across industries. As businesses adapt to an ever-changing economic landscape, agility in hiring and workforce planning will become essential to staying competitive. Furthermore, ongoing government initiatives to support lower-wage workers will likely create more opportunities for upskilling and career advancement, contributing to a more inclusive and resilient workforce.

About Jobstreet Express

Jobstreet Express is an online employment platform designed to simplify the job-matching process for semi-skilled segments. As part of Jobstreet by SEEK, the leading online employment marketplace in Singapore, Jobstreet Express enables candidates to instantly apply for part-time, temporary and full-time positions in sectors like hospitality, retail, customer service and logistics, with quick responses from employers. To learn more, visit or download the app on Google Play Store or the App Store.

About SEEK

SEEK operates market-leading online employment marketplaces, including Jobstreet and Jobsdb. SEEK's purpose is to help people live more fulfilling and productive working lives and help organisations succeed. Listed on the Australian Securities Exchange (ASX: SEK), SEEK has a multinational presence that is focused on Australia, New Zealand, Hong Kong, Indonesia, Malaysia, the Philippines, Singapore and Thailand.
